Blogdowntown suspends print weekly

bdownown-print-feb32011.jpgBlogdowntown's weekly print edition hit the streets last August, and it stopped regular publication in February. The online site continues for now, but founder and editor Eric Richardson sounds unsure what the future holds. "I wish I had better answers in terms of what comes next, but right now all I can say is that definitely we saw that newsprint still works and the issues we ran into were really just ones of ad sales and
frequency," he told me. "For us, being weekly pushed the focus too much toward news and away from strong calendar and lifestyle, which was always what I set out believing print needed to be about."
